"Anti-Racism Training Doesn't Work" - Dr Karlyn Borysenko
chevron_right
In this discussion, Dr. Karlyn Borysenko, an organizational psychologist and author, critiques the effectiveness of anti-racism training in workplaces. She shares insights on how the pandemic has transformed work dynamics and emphasizes the importance of interpersonal relationships in remote settings. Borysenko delves into the rising anger among younger generations, fueled by social media, and stresses the need for resilience against online bullying. The conversation also touches on the intersection of social justice issues with personal identity and workplace culture.
